Digital StormLAS VEGAS - (January 8, 2013) – Digital Storm, the predominant name in computer system integration and engineering, unveils Aventum II -- the next leap in the evolution of custom, high-performance PC design.  The original Aventum, a Popular Science 2012 Best of What’s New award winner, was recognized for its ground breaking liquid cooling solution.  Aventum II takes that proprietary cooling design to another level with the addition of nickel plated copper piping that dramatically increases system durability while providing a visual aesthetic enthusiasts will drool over.

In addition, a newly designed control board put’s management of Aventum II’s vast array of up to 22 fans at the user’s fingertips via exclusive software.  Another notable achievement is the new exhaust chamber design.  The redesigned thermal compartment is now divided into two separate channels by a middle panel.  The separation causes less air congestion and with fans at the front and back of the thermal chamber, improves airflow and dramatically increases the cooling efficiency of Aventum II’ s high performance components.
